Description

A Value Pack of CR2450 Batteries that are fresh, at 3 Volt, with full charge. They use Lithium Manganese Dioxide chemical system to provide reliable power for a variety of personal and professional devices. They are designed to maintain power during storage for up to 5 years. They power devices like flameless candles, security sensors, helmets, key fobs and so on.

  • Testing results and making sure they work
I have tested these batteries in depth over the last two years and here is what I've come up with versus Energizer version of these same batteries. What I tested them in: Garage door openers, car key fobs and remotes, garage door sensors for alarms, a small flashlight, a headlamp, a handheld radio, couple of other small household remotes etc. A few caveats: All batteries were as fresh as I could get them. Straight out of the packages. The Energizer were the best lithium ones that energizer sells. These batteries were all put straight into use except for the ones I used for shelf testing. 1. In terms of voltage, they are nominal 3V usually starting around 3.3 or so. Some however started lower, even out of the same package, some were ~3.3 other were as low as 3.0 which is starting to show age. Every single Energizer I tried was near ~3.3 Volts. Very little variability with the energizers. 2. When being used in lightly used applications, say a garage door remote, these batteries do fine although the do not last as long as the energizers meaning the mah is a bit less. 3. When shelf testing (Just leaving them on the shelf unused) these batteries deteriorated much quicker than the energizers. After 2 years the energizers showed no detectable degradation and a majority of these batteries showed some sort of degradation just sitting on the shelf while a whole 10% were fully dead with another whole 10% basically still at full charge. 4. In heavy drain applications, say a really bright led headlamp, these things die quick in comparison to the energizers. My overall testing showed: 90+ mah (usually around 92 for the Energizers) and around 64 mah for these batteries. Bottom line: Are they worth it? In my opinion yes, here is why: They cost 1/3rd as much but you are getting over half the capacity. Yes you have to change these batteries not quite about twice as often as the energizers but if it's easy, the price per mah can't be beat. If you need these for a long term stand-by or want to install them in something you want to change as little as possible, use the Energizers or Duracell or the like. Far more expensive, but last longer. For a critical device of some kind, I'd use Energizers or Duracell. For an every day device, I'll use these all day, twice on Sunday. Although I did get a couple that were marginal right out of the package, taking those into account, but accounting for price, how long some of them actually did last, I found this: If you test them first, and put in the ones that have close to 3.3V you'll find they last about 75% of the time the Energizers do. These batteries can be hit or miss, but what do you expect for the price? These are a good buy if you know what you're getting into. ... show more
